About the Position: Bluefish is looking for a Director of Finance to help scale our finance function as we grow through our next stage of expansion. This person will own FP&A and strategic finance while also overseeing core accounting and controllership functions to ensure the company has strong financial discipline, clean reporting, and scalable processes. This is a high-impact role for someone who can operate as both a strategic partner to the business and a hands-on leader who can drive accuracy, controls, and rigor across the finance and accounting function. What You’ll Do Finance leadership + business partnership (FP&A) Own the company’s budgeting, forecasting, and long-range planning processes (monthly/quarterly/annual) Build and maintain the core SaaS financial model and operating metrics (ARR, NRR, GRR, CAC, LTV, payback, churn) Partner with GTM leadership to forecast bookings, pipeline health, and capacity planning Partner with Product/Engineering on headcount planning, spend forecasting, and ROI analysis Drive monthly variance analysis and executive-level narrative on performance and key drivers Own executive dashboards and Board reporting materials Accounting oversight + controllership responsibilities Oversee the monthly, quarterly, and annual close process to ensure accuracy, timeliness, and quality Manage internal accounting resources and external accounting firms Maintain strong financial controls, approvals, and audit-ready processes as the company scales Ensure compliance and correct treatment for: Revenue recognition (ASC 606) Deferred revenue and billing operations Accruals and prepaid expenses Compensation expense and equity accounting coordination Expense classification and department-level reporting Manage key accounting workflows including: Accounts payable and vendor management Payroll coordination and reconciliations Bank and balance sheet reconciliations General ledger integrity and chart of accounts evolution Own preparation and support for annual audits, tax filings, and other compliance needs (in partnership with external providers) Implement and improve core systems and workflows (NetSuite/QBO, Ramp, Stripe, Bill.com, etc.) Finance operations + scaling Build scalable processes for spend management, cash management, procurement, and budgeting discipline across the org Improve tools and reporting systems to support real-time visibility into performance Support hiring and development of the finance team over time Strategic initiatives Support fundraising, investor reporting, and diligence requests Partner on pricing, packaging, and unit economics improvement initiatives Evaluate strategic opportunities including vendor negotiations and operational efficiency initiatives   What We’re Looking For 8–12+ years of experience across finance, FP&A, and accounting (startup and/or high-growth environments strongly preferred) Experience owning or overseeing accounting close cycles and controllership responsibi...
